Finally beat the raid.

The big game changer on Calus for our group is that the Coldheart is not effective unless you get a LOT of stacks from skulls. Like if you are 90 deep in skulls you are set. We did WAY better with everyone rocking a Merciless. Like people went from 400k damage on a damage phase, to 800k doing this. We melted him in just 2 cycles.

Also from a lore standpoint can someone help me understand ?
So Ghaul was pointless AF. He was part of red legion which was a bunch of people who betrayed the emperor. They help off the speaker apparently, and made the Traveler blows its load to kill Ghaul and alert the darkness of where it is. So now Calus, he is the emperor of the actual original Cabal Empire. He rides a giant space worm for a ship and feeds it planets. Is the worm dead? He invites you to be entertained by you on his ship. You find out once you beat him that it wasn't him, but simply a robot version which he has thousands of within the Leviathan under his throne room. He says something eerie like you are on the wrong side of this fight. Is the traveller and our use of his light making us the bad guys? I'm confused by what D2's initial story has set up.

Yeah, thats the gist of it.

Its heavily implied through the lore tabs that he saw The Darkness proper out in space somewhere, and seems to be won over by it. Hes testing Guardians because we helped him out (by killing Ghaul), wants to make us assets he can use, and it sounds like he wants us to play for “the winning team” when the Darkness comes.

The collector’s edition also implies hes made a pact with an Ahamkara (bad news).

It awaits to be seen where this leads, but the whole rais was just a formality - we didn’t kill him, and it sounds like Ghaul and the Consul couldn’t either. My hunch is because he is some kind of psychic entity (which would legitimize his claims of being a god) who “lives” through his robo avatars.

Also we learned through a concept art dump the Leviathan is based on Dune-esque worms on thhe Cabal home planet. Pretty cool!
